Whether you choose to grow figs from seed, air layering, stool layering, tip layering, rooting fig cuttings, or grafting, there are many methods of propagating fig trees to choose from, each with its own set of pros and cons. You can take a cutting from a fig tree any time of the year except in the winter. When the tree is dormant in the winter, the cutting will be as well.
